Output 8177962fca1b511df3a3463d00aed822fe9c66c3c39ecb80bbd6a1fb136b1d24:0

value
52808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74682491995a714448f6a12cbc41c4e35fb7f86a OP_EQUAL
address
3CJX4mVYpavqXYkDuojAc5VRC6fyV4aELj
transaction
8177962fca1b511df3a3463d00aed822fe9c66c3c39ecb80bbd6a1fb136b1d24
spent
true